4-0 at SCG Night!
AngryChewie, 9 years ago
The deck won my lgs's SCG modern night! First round was against storm. Won the first game of first round a turn before storm could go off. Second game he went off turn 4 before I could get the last bit of damage in. Game three I mulligan'd to get a leyline and he forgot to sideboard against it so he just conceded. Second round was against grixis control which heavily favored me. My threats were just bigger and his spot removal did nothing. Third round was against hatebears. Game one was his after preventing me from cracking fetches and then ghost quartering my first two lands. Game two went to me because I had a great opening hand that he couldnt race. Game three was scary because he had a wide board and I was dead in a turn before I drew a daybreak to start lifegaining on a big boggle. Emptied my hand on the boggle, lifegained from 10 to 55 in a couple swings, and then he played a spellskite along with scavenging ooze. He had a liege and voice of resurgence on the field already so after a few turns of pumping the ooze he got it big enough so that he could take on my boggle if I swung again. Couldn't pump the boggle anymore because of the spellskite either unless it was a daybreak so the game became a stalemate for 4 turns until I drew a path for the spellskite and then pumped boggle with a few more spells including spirit mantle to swing for lethal past his blockers. Final round was against twin. Game 1 was his after comboing on turn 5. Game 2 went to me after he blood moon'd himself and I put a suppression field into play. Game 3 was scary close with him almost combo'ing, but me having a nature's claim in hand to stop it. Proceeded to get another suppression field into play on the draw next turn and from there I beat face. He had a cryptic command in his gy and was 1 mana short of snapping it back and bouncing suppression field. If he did that I would have been in serious trouble.

misc thoughts
mookie990, 9 years ago
Played the deck for the first time in a while, and made a few observations about where I want to take it. Not making any changes right at this moment, but I intend to pick up Seize Control (the UR precon) and use it to fill in some gaps. Deck functioned fine overall - game ended in a draw after ~2 hours with minimal progress being made by anyone.
Thoughts:
-I should run more instant-speed stuff. This deck really wants to be able to hold mana open - either for removal, or counterspells, or Zedruu activations. Would also like some more counterspells (Forbid!)
-On a related note, I should develop some better threat assessment when it comes to what things are worth countering. Most creatures aren't due to the number of wraths I run and the fact that I don't get attacked that often.
-Reliquary Tower is very, very important. Should hunt down a Thought Vessel and Venser's Journal to complement it.
-Cut Spellweaver Volute. The card is awesome, but this deck doesn't run enough sorceries, and many of the ones that are being run are wraths, which you don't necessarily want to use.
-Donated enchantments stick around fairly reliably... until someone uses mass enchantment removal, which is a bit more common than I realized. Still not common, but there are a decent number of flexible wraths than can hit them.
-Deck still desperately wants Goblin Charbelcher. I should also see if there are some other easy wincons that could be added.
-I should try using a counter to track how many things have been donated.
